+module DiffOps
+
+using RegionIndices
+using SbpOperators
+using Grids
+using LazyTensors
+
+"""
+    DiffOp
+
+Supertype of differential operator discretisations.
+The action of the DiffOp is defined in the method
+    apply(D::DiffOp, v::AbstractVector, I...)
+"""
+abstract type DiffOp end
+
+function apply end
+
+function matrixRepresentation(D::DiffOp)
+    error("not implemented")
+end
+
+abstract type DiffOpCartesian{Dim} <: DiffOp end
+
+# DiffOp must have a grid of dimension Dim!!!
+function apply!(D::DiffOpCartesian{Dim}, u::AbstractArray{T,Dim}, v::AbstractArray{T,Dim}) where {T,Dim}
+    for I ∈ eachindex(D.grid)
+        u[I] = apply(D, v, I)
+    end
+
+    return nothing
+end
+export apply!
+
+function apply_region!(D::DiffOpCartesian{2}, u::AbstractArray{T,2}, v::AbstractArray{T,2}) where T
+    apply_region!(D, u, v, Lower, Lower)
+    apply_region!(D, u, v, Lower, Interior)
+    apply_region!(D, u, v, Lower, Upper)
+    apply_region!(D, u, v, Interior, Lower)
+    apply_region!(D, u, v, Interior, Interior)
+    apply_region!(D, u, v, Interior, Upper)
+    apply_region!(D, u, v, Upper, Lower)
+    apply_region!(D, u, v, Upper, Interior)
+    apply_region!(D, u, v, Upper, Upper)
+    return nothing
+end
+
+# Maybe this should be split according to b3fbef345810 after all?! Seems like it makes performance more predictable
+function apply_region!(D::DiffOpCartesian{2}, u::AbstractArray{T,2}, v::AbstractArray{T,2}, r1::Type{<:Region}, r2::Type{<:Region}) where T
+    for I ∈ regionindices(D.grid.size, closuresize(D.op), (r1,r2))
+        @inbounds indextuple = (Index{r1}(I[1]), Index{r2}(I[2]))
+        @inbounds u[I] = apply(D, v, indextuple)
+    end
+    return nothing
+end
+export apply_region!
+
+function apply_tiled!(D::DiffOpCartesian{2}, u::AbstractArray{T,2}, v::AbstractArray{T,2}) where T
+    apply_region_tiled!(D, u, v, Lower, Lower)
+    apply_region_tiled!(D, u, v, Lower, Interior)
+    apply_region_tiled!(D, u, v, Lower, Upper)
+    apply_region_tiled!(D, u, v, Interior, Lower)
+    apply_region_tiled!(D, u, v, Interior, Interior)
+    apply_region_tiled!(D, u, v, Interior, Upper)
+    apply_region_tiled!(D, u, v, Upper, Lower)
+    apply_region_tiled!(D, u, v, Upper, Interior)
+    apply_region_tiled!(D, u, v, Upper, Upper)
+    return nothing
+end
+
+using TiledIteration
+function apply_region_tiled!(D::DiffOpCartesian{2}, u::AbstractArray{T,2}, v::AbstractArray{T,2}, r1::Type{<:Region}, r2::Type{<:Region}) where T
+    ri = regionindices(D.grid.size, closuresize(D.op), (r1,r2))
+    # TODO: Pass Tilesize to function
+    for tileaxs ∈ TileIterator(axes(ri), padded_tilesize(T, (5,5), 2))
+        for j ∈ tileaxs[2], i ∈ tileaxs[1]
+            I = ri[i,j]
+            u[I] = apply(D, v, (Index{r1}(I[1]), Index{r2}(I[2])))
+        end
+    end
+    return nothing
+end
+export apply_region_tiled!
+
+function apply(D::DiffOp, v::AbstractVector)::AbstractVector
+    u = zeros(eltype(v), size(v))
+    apply!(D,v,u)
+    return u
+end
+
+export apply
+
+"""
+A BoundaryCondition should implement the method
+    sat(::DiffOp, v::AbstractArray, data::AbstractArray, ...)
+"""
+abstract type BoundaryCondition end
+
+
+end # module
